So, what is "Watch the Skies" and what the heck is a megagame?
A megagame is large social political simulation designed as a one-day event with the goal of providing a challenging, interesting, and fun interactive environment for participants. It has elements of strategy gaming as well as a lot of diplomacy in a model UN, between teams, and with some roleplaying.
Participants play the game in teams and take on specific roles for that team. In the case of "Watch the Skies," players will become a high ranking official in a national government, a member of a corporate board, become part of an international press team, or one of the mysterious alien commanders.
Within their teams, each player takes on different roles as the game unfolds. Some handle the military situation, attempting to maintain control of the world through the deployment of forces while others test their wits and rhetoric with international diplomacy and attend the UN to help shape global policy. The press scrambles to discern the truth, as government and corporate interests cover-up suspicious crash-sites and limit access, all while the world holds its breath and watches the skies.
